1969 First Printing Hardcover of “THE INNER CITY MOTHER GOOSE”, poems by Eve Merriam and illustrations and pictures by Lawrence Ratzkin. Published by Simon and Schuster. Very rare book, especially the hardcover version like this. This is a First Edition, First Printing. This is a very radical hard left book, a parody transforming comforting nursery rhymes of the Mother Goose genre into angry biting anti-establishment short poems. This was 1969, a very polarizing and violent year, or set of years, where America was in turmoil abroad (Vietnam) and at home (riots in the inner cities, and high city crime rates).
